Water Removal Service: DIY vs. Professional Help

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small sink overflow on tile floor Yes No You can likely handle a small sink overflow on your own with a wet/dry vacuum and some towels.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es A flooded basement with standing water need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age.
Wet drywall behind cabinets No Yes Wet drywall behind cabinets need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a safe living environment.
Minor water damage from a leaky pipe Yes No You can likely handle minor water damage from a leaky pipe on your own with some towels and a wet/dry vacuum.
Severe water damage from a burst pipe No Yes Severe water damage from a burst pipe need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a safe living environment.
Hidden water damage behind walls No Yes Hidden water damage behind walls need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air.

Water Removal Service Cost In The 30090 Area

Water removal service costs vary based on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in the 30090 area. These are estimates, not guarantees. Get a free estimate today to find out the cost of our services.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Structural Drying Process $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ials affected
Moisture Detection and Monitoring $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, complexity of job
Sewage Cleanup $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area, type of sewage
Basement Flood Recovery $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Water Damage Restoration $3,000 – $15,000 Size of affected area, type of materials affected
